Key Insights
The African stevia market, valued at approximately $50 million in 2025, is projected to experience robust growth, with a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.40%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. The increasing prevalence of diabetes and other health concerns across the continent is fueling consumer demand for natural, low-calorie sweeteners like stevia. Furthermore, growing awareness of the negative health impacts of artificial sweeteners is contributing to the shift towards healthier alternatives. The burgeoning food and beverage industry in Africa, particularly in segments like bakery, confectionery, dairy, and beverages, provides significant opportunities for stevia adoption. The diversification of stevia product forms, including powder, liquid, and leaf, caters to various consumer preferences and industrial applications, further stimulating market growth. While challenges like limited awareness in certain regions and the relatively high cost of stevia compared to traditional sweeteners exist, the overall market outlook remains positive due to the strong underlying trends. Leading players like Biolotus Technology, Lasa Inc., Cargill Incorporated, HYET Sweet, Tate & Lyle PLC, PureCircle, and GLG LIFE TECH CORP are actively shaping the market landscape through product innovation and strategic partnerships, further accelerating growth within this expanding sector.
The market segmentation shows significant potential across various applications. The bakery and confectionery sectors are expected to be major drivers of growth, followed by the dairy and beverage industries. Dietary supplements incorporating stevia are also gaining traction, reflecting the increasing health consciousness of African consumers. Regional variations exist, with South Africa, Kenya, and other East African nations currently leading the market. However, untapped potential remains in other parts of the continent, presenting opportunities for market expansion through increased awareness campaigns and targeted distribution strategies. The ongoing trend towards healthier lifestyles and the increasing adoption of stevia in various food and beverage products contribute to a positive and promising forecast for the African stevia market in the coming years.

Africa Stevia Market Product Landscape
Stevia products are available in various forms, including powder, liquid extracts, and leaves. Innovations focus on enhancing taste profiles and improving functionalities to meet diverse applications across the food and beverage industry. Technological advancements in extraction processes have led to higher-purity stevia products, eliminating off-notes and ensuring better sweetness. Unique selling propositions often focus on natural origin, zero-calorie content, and suitability for various dietary needs.
